New yard bird!!
Today Anne spotted and I saw prothonotary warbler at the water in the yard. It moved into the hedge and started grooming.
They breed close by but we haven't seen or heard one in the yard before.
Not the greatest image but for something like this you take what you can get.

Protonotaria citrea
Most warblers nest either on the ground, in shrubs, or in trees, but the Prothonotary Warbler and the Lucy's Warbler build their nests in holes in standing dead trees. They may also use nest boxes when available.
